Here goes blog quotes #98....

"Don't forget to take life one day at a time, because if you miss a day or two... its called a coma."

-Tom Zegan-

Anyone in a 'hurry' in life? Can't wait for this week to be over? Wishig that vacation in April was here; now? Summer can't get here soon enough for you?

Well, pretty soon all of these will be here and have passed us. Zegar is making a joke of the literal translation of missing a day or two meaning if you really do miss it, you've either passed on to the next life, or you are in a coma.

Perhaps he leaves a subtle, yet wise message to SLOW DOWN. Enjoy life one day at a time. Live in the moment. Today's moment. Whatever you are "waiting for" will come and it will be gone just as fast. In the meantime, don't miss out on what TODAY has in store for you. Remember Ferris Buhler's famous line.. "Life moves pretty fast. If you don't stop and look around once in a while, you could miss it."
